What is social stress and anxiety?
Social nervousness disorder (Unhappy) is usually a mental health issue by which someone activities powerful fear of social circumstances, usually on the extent of preventing or proscribing participation at social situations for fear of getting judged, humiliated, or rejected by Some others. Their fears frequently outstrip actual dangers involved with any offered scenario. Folks diagnosed with social stress ailment also tend to possess persistent, extreme, and irrational thoughts about themselves in specific social circumstances and may show Actual physical signs or symptoms of panic like blushing, trembling, sweating or difficulty Talking when Assembly Other folks.

Latest study indicates that social panic could possibly be due to biological, environmental and genetic influences coupled with issues with neurotransmitter techniques within the Mind. In addition, publish-traumatic worry ailment (PTSD), despair or other mental health and fitness ailments could induce it also.

Social anxiety differs from shyness in that it interferes with each day routines for its sufferers, normally generating faculty, operate and social conversation tough or leading to loneliness and suicidal thoughts. Trying to get therapy might enable folks manage their thoughts of panic and stress a lot more effectively and also become a lot more at ease social scenarios.

How am i able to treat social panic?
Wellness treatment companies typically get started by conducting a physical Examination to rule out unrelated healthcare will cause to your indications just before referring you to definitely a mental well being Qualified for psychotherapy (also called chat therapy) and drugs as powerful solutions for social stress and anxiety dysfunction.

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is a kind of psychotherapy intended that can assist you recognize and modify the ideas that lead to stress and anxiety, in addition to produce more practical coping strategies. CBT typically incorporates abilities education and job-actively playing sessions being a technique for practicing new strategies and slowly struggling with situations that result in stress. CBT can be finished one-on-one or in group settings, with exposure-based mostly CBT, often called systematic desensitization, remaining a person such type. It includes steadily Doing work up to your most terrifying scenarios whilst beginning with much less horrifying types 1st.

Antidepressants may present further support for anyone suffering from social stress and anxiety. Sel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s), like paroxetine (Paxil) or sertraline (Zoloft), are Amongst the most frequently employed varieties of medication employed for social panic; these SSRIs do the job by expanding serotonin stages within your Mind, which lowers nervousness whilst improving your temper; your well being care provider may perhaps get started you over a reduced dose right before slowly growing it; another SNRI alternative venlafaxine (Effexor XR) could also work in the same way.

What exactly are the indicators of social panic?
Social panic ailment results in individuals to encounter Intense concern or nervousness in social conditions that is certainly outside of proportion with perceived threats. People today afflicted may perhaps stay clear of cases which make them anxious, or endure it anyway Regardless of feeling fearful; symptoms involve blushing, perspiring, trembling, nausea and issues speaking or creating eye contact; the fear they experience may well lead to Other individuals to find out it and cause destructive self-impression and minimal self-esteem in them Consequently; sometimes persons Will not understand why they experience in this manner and Feel it is usual Portion of being shy or their temperament trait!

Cognitive Behavioral Therapy and drugs are often merged in treating social panic condition. CBT allows the person figure out and change destructive beliefs about social scenarios; as well as build up braveness to encounter Those people which frighten them - with aid from their therapist certainly! Exposure therapy (cognitive sent publicity) enables persons steadily deal with scenarios which result in anxiousness when remaining safe, including an Business meeting with coworkers or attending a birthday get together for mates.

Medication to treat social nervousness dysfunction more info can offer much-necessary reduction. You will discover various medicines offered, and people today may need to try a number of ahead of acquiring a person that actually works. Sel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RI), like paroxetine (Paxil), sertraline (Zoloft), or venlafaxine (Effexor XR) are usually efficient, although benzododiazepines for example alprazolam (Xanax) or diazepam (Valium) may well assistance. At last, beta blockers assist with Actual physical indications like rapid coronary heart level, pounding of heartbeat, shaking voice/limbs etcetera.
